Memphis suburban school districts united in opposition to vouchers
“I’ve heard lawmakers say education competition is good to increase student achievement. Fair competition is dependent on an even playing field,” Jason Manuel, superintendent of Germantown Municipal School District, stressed in a video posted last weekend. (Brad Vest/Special to The Daily Memphian)
Suburban school districts have come out swiftly and strongly against Gov. Lee’s expansion of the state’s education voucher program.
